World-class golf is expected when the 2025 Maybank Championship returns to Kuala Lumpur.
-
Golf fans in Malaysia will have the privilege to watch no less than 18 winners from the 2025 LPGA Tour play at the 2025 Maybank Championship which returns to Kuala Lumpur Golf & Country Club (KLGCC) this 30 October to 2 November. World No. 1 Jeeno Thitikul of Thailand will headline the stellar field.
Known for her aggressive game and shot-making prowess, the hugely-popular Thitikul will return to KLGCC determined to convert consistency into history as she attempts to chase down the title that has twice eluded her narrowly. But she will have defending champion Ruoning Yin of China, and 2023 winner Celine Boutier of France in her way.
Australian Grace Kim, who claimed her maiden Major title and second LPGA victory at this year's Evian Championship following a dramatic playoff with Thitikul, will also be among the contenders and drawcards at KLGCC.
